Top Causes of Home Water Leaks
Leaks not just create waste of water but can also trigger unnecessary damages to your house as well as promote undesirable organic development. By recognizing and looking for everyday situations that cause leaks, you can secure your residence from future leaks and also unnecessary damages.

Encroaching origins


The majority of water leakages begin outside your home rather than inside it. If you observe an unexpected reduction in water pressure, claim in your faucet, require time to go out and also examine your backyard. You may observe damp spots or sinkholes in your backyard, which could suggest that tree origins are invading water lines causing water to leak out. You can have your plumber check for invasion, specifically if you have trees or hedges near your residential property.

Corroded water supply


This could be the reason of staining or warping on your water pipelines. If our plumbing system is old, think about replacing the pipelines given that they are at a higher threat of deterioration than the more recent designs.

Malfunctioning Pipeline Joints


Pipe joints can wear away over time, resulting in water leaks. If you have loud pipelines that make ticking or banging noises, particularly when the hot water is transformed on, your pipe joints are probably under a whole lot of stress.

Immediate temperature changes.


Extreme temperature changes in our pipelines can cause them to increase as well as acquire all of a sudden. This development and contraction may create splits in the pipes, especially if the temperature level are below freezing. If you maintained an eye on just how your plumbing functions, it would be best. The visibility of the previously discussed circumstances regularly indicates a high risk.

Poor Water Connectors


Sometimes, a leak can be caused by loosened hose pipes as well as pipes that provide your home appliances. Usually, moving is what causes the loosened water Links. You may locate in the case of a washing maker, a hose may spring a leakage as a result of trembling during the spin cycle. In case of a water links leak, you may see water running straight from the supply line or pools around your devices.

Blocked Drains


Clogged drains could be frustrating as well as inconveniencing, however they can occasionally end up causing an overflow bring about rupture pipes. Maintain removing any materials that might decrease your drains that could block them to stay clear of such hassles.

TYPES OF WATER LEAKS YOU SHOULD BE FAMILIAR WITH


Shower Fixture Water Leaks


If you notice a water leak near your shower fixture, perform an inspection to confirm if you are able to find broken caulk lines. As your shower fixture becomes older, it is not uncommon for water to leak onto the other side of the frame. To fix this type of plumbing leak, scrape off the old caulk and run a new bead of it around the shower fixture to seal up any fractured crevices and holes.


Bathtub Drainage Water leaks


To fix this type of leak in a bathtub, remove the drain flange and clean it. Next, you should also remove the rubber gasket located beneath the tub’s drain hole. Buy a replacement gasket that matches the old version and install it in the same location. Once the drain flange and rubber gasket are installed, apply a small amount of silicone caulk to the drain to prevent water leakage below your tub.


Water Pipe Leaks Behind Walls


Issues such as discolored grout and loose shower tiles may be caused by a water pipe leak behind the walls in your bathroom. To fix this plumbing leak, you will be required to remove the tiles, grout, or caulk in your shower. Once the tiles in your shower have been removed, perform an inspection of the drywall to confirm if it’s moist or wet. If you notice water marks or mold on the wall, this is an indicator of a water pipe leak.


Toilet Leaks


Nobody likes a toilet leak. It can cause water damage to the subfloor, joists, or even the ceiling in the room below. To combat this type of water leak, you will need to reinstall your toilet with a brand new ring of wax. If the toilet sits uneven, be sure to add toilet shims to correct the issue. Do you notice a broken bolt slot or flange? We recommend performing a new metal flange installation to remediate this issue.


Sink Water Leaks


To prevent damage to the beautiful counter tops in your kitchen or bathroom, tighten the base of your sink to prevent a water leak. Next, scrape away any old caulk around the sink and apply a fresh coat. Prior to using the kitchen or bathroom sink, you will need to secure the fixture to the countertop with the clips located beneath the sink rim to prevent a water leak.
